How to be Brilliant at Materials contains 42 photocopiable worksheets with practical activities to help children acquire knowledge and understanding of the way materials are classified, how they can be changed, and ways of separating them. Topics include: testing for hardness, density, porosity, magnetism, conductivity of heat and electricity, and flexibility; materials used in houses; comparing soils; solids, liquids and gases; mixtures; changing materials; dissolving, filtering and evaporation; the water cycle; energy efficiency.

How to be Brilliant at Science Investigations contains 40 worksheets with activities, to help Key Stage 2 (KS2), 7-11 year old pupils develop the skills needed to plan and carry out investigations and to draw conclusions from the results. Topics covered include: Tooth decay, Muscles, Seeds, Habitats, Testing washing powders, Red cabbage water magic, Pinhole cameras, Camouflage, Making the best telephone, Light bulbs and Where is the Sun now?

How to be Brilliant at Shape and Space contains 40 photocopiable worksheets designed to improve pupils' understanding of shape, their understanding of position and movement and their understanding of measure. They will learn about: angles; nets; Euler's formula; the Platonic solids; squares, triangles and quadrilaterals; parallel lines; lines of symmetry, and reflective and rotational symmetry.

Mental arithmetic is now an important part of the school curriculum in both primary and secondary schools. How to be Brilliant at Mental Arithmetic contains over 40 photocopiable activities to help children develop the skills needed to do fast and accurate mathematical calculations. The sheets introduce a variety of techniques and strategies and provide opportunities for children to practise, reinforce and assimilate their new skills. How to be a Brilliant FE Teacher is a straightforward, friendly guide to being an effective and innovative teacher in post-compulsory education. Focussing on practical advice drawn from the author’s extensive and successful personal experience of both teaching and training teachers, it offers sound guidance, underpinned by the latest research, theory and policy in the field. Structured around the questions that all new teachers and lecturers ask in their first teaching post, it is an introduction to both essential teaching skills and what to expect from working in this exciting, fast-paced sector. Key chapters cover: The learners – who they are, diversity and motivation; What will actually happen – organising teaching, technology and resources; How to keep your students’ interest – understanding and responding to learning styles; How will I know if they’ve learned it? – assessment and feedback; Making sure it’s working – student evaluation, reflecting on and improving practice. Packed throughout with information about where to find the best materials and resources to support your teaching, this book also offers sensible advice on balancing home and life, working effectively with your colleagues and progressing in your career. How to be a Brilliant FE Teacher will be a source of support and inspiration for all those embarking on their initial training and first post in the sector, as well as qualified professionals looking for reassuring, fresh ideas.
